The Radiology Directorate within ABUHB are seeking to recruit an enthusiastic and highly motivated individual to join their Administrative and clerical team.

The successful candidate of this exciting post will be an integral member of the Radiology Booking Service. 2 posts available, 15 hours is based at Ystrad Mynach hospital (2 days) and 15 hours at Royal Gwent Hospital (2 days)

Working as part of a dedicated team of Inpatient booking staff, Radiologists, Radiographers and nurses, they will be responsible for the day-to-day admin operation and maintenance of outpatient appointments for Radiology across the Health Board. The post holder will ensure service users have a positive and professional experience at all times.

The ability to speak Welsh is desirable for this post; Welsh and/or English speakers are equally welcome to apply.

The duties of this new post includes,
• Ensuring all patients appointments are processed in accordance with the internal and national targets.
• Inpatient bookings, Radiology admin support and wait list management
• Working with Supt Songraphers and Team leader making sure that clinic capacity is utilised so cancellations are kept to a minimum
• All procedure appointments are booked in a timely fashion utilising list capacity across Radiology in ABUHB.
• Liaising with other team members to ensure that waiting times are kept to a minimum, working with the radiology referral and booking manager and booking service team
• Ensure a professional and friendly telephone manner is maintained



Aneurin Bevan University Health Board is a multi-award winning NHS organisation with a passion for caring. The Health Board provides an exceptional workplace where you can feel trusted and valued. Whatever your specialty or stage in your career, we have opportunities for everyone to start, grow and build your career. The health board provides integrated acute, primary and community care serving a population of 650,000 and employing over 16,000 staff.

We offer a fantastic benefits package and extensive training and development opportunities with paid mandatory training, excellent in-house programmes, opportunities to complete recognised qualifications and professional career pathways including a range of management development programmes. We offer flexible working and promote a healthy work life balance, provide occupational health support and an ambitious plan for a Wellbeing Centre of Excellence to support you at work.

Our Clinical Futures strategy continues to enhance and promote care closer to home as well as high quality hospital care when needed. This includes the Grange University Hospital which provides specialist and critical care and is the newest addition to the clinical futures strategy opening in November 2020.
